knowledge the purpose of Gooseneck Punches in CNC push Brakes

Gooseneck punches Perform a significant purpose in the bending approach by presenting Remarkable flexibility and precision. compared with standard punches, a gooseneck punch is uniquely curved to support elaborate air bending treatments, making it possible for suppliers to bend intricate designs without detrimental the fabric or tooling. They can be most often used in CNC press brakes, devices intended to bend metal by forming straight or angled lines. These devices depend on compatibility with dependable tooling, and gooseneck punches stand out for his or her capability to adapt to intricate varieties.What can make gooseneck punches so significant is their power to execute bends that may normally be difficult with straight punches. In addition they help air bending, which makes use of less force and Electricity in comparison with bottoming or coining approaches. This functional flexibility will make them a fantastic choice for Superior fabrication needs. From architectural factors to engineering elements, the precision provided by gooseneck punches would make them a real asset for producers working in industries that desire exactitude.

How Gooseneck Punch style and design stops Material Collision During Bending

The key to your achievement of gooseneck punches lies in their clever design. Their distinctive "gooseneck" shape prevents collision involving the punch and Earlier shaped flanges or bends. This is especially valuable when creating components with sophisticated profiles or large, narrow flanges Which may or else interfere with normal punch functions.The curved higher part of the punch offers clearance that avoids detrimental the products or Device, rendering it perfect for here scenarios necessitating deep and complicated bends. producers can limit pricey output mistakes considering that the material is never compressed or improperly bent. This also improves efficiency by getting rid of the necessity for additional ways, including reworking or manually re-aligning the sheet metal. Also, the look of gooseneck punches permits extra uniform tension distribution over the air bending approach, which lowers don and tear within the tools and makes sure steady, substantial-good quality effects across all output runs. Precision architects, engineers, and assemblies depend on this Sophisticated tooling feature to considerably greatly enhance productivity devoid of forfeiting excellent.
